Data on ________ is most likely to be collected using surveys,interviews,and focus groups.

A) customer satisfaction
B) material usage
C) sales
D) fixed input costs

Customer Satisfaction

A measure of how products or services meet or surpass customer expectations, an important factor in maintaining and growing customer relationships.

Surveys

Methodologies used to collect data from individuals about their thoughts, experiences, or behaviors, often through questionnaires or interviews.

Focus Groups

A qualitative research method where a small group of people discusses a product, service, or topic under the guidance of a moderator to gather opinions and feedback.

Final Answer :
A
Explanation :
Customer satisfaction is a subjective measure that cannot be quantified by simply looking at sales or other financial data. Surveys, interviews, and focus groups are effective ways to gather customers' opinions and feedback on their experiences with a product or service. Material usage, sales, and fixed input costs can be measured using quantitative data sources such as production records and financial statements.
